Mesothelioma Attorney

A mesothelioma lawyer will review your medical records, work history and other documents related to your service to discover evidence of asbestos exposure. The lawyer will conduct an investigation to determine who is responsible for your compensation.

Your lawyer can file a personal injury or wrongful death suit, and trust fund claim on your behalf. They will ensure that all legal proceedings are completed in accordance with state laws.

Experience

A mesothelioma lawyer is a legal professional who has experience representing victims of asbestos-related diseases.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should have a proven track record of obtaining compensation for their clients. Compensation can help families pay for medical expenses and other expenses.

A mesothelioma lawyer who has experience will also be aware of the challenges of a diagnosis and treatment for mesothelioma. They will be familiar with how to minimize your stress during the lawsuit process and will ensure that you receive the best financial award possible.

Mesothelioma lawyers can help you identify potential sources of exposure to asbestos, which includes your past workplaces and other areas where you could have been exposed. They can demonstrate asbestos exposure in court by studying company records or hiring experts such as industrial hygiene experts.

A mesothelioma lawsuits lawyer firm should have experience in filing asbestos trust fund claims as well as personal injury and wrongful death lawsuits. They should also have a nationwide reach so they can serve clients across the nation. The top mesothelioma law firm lawyers will offer a free legal case review to determine whether compensation is available. They will also explain the state statutes and the best way to ensure that you file your claim before the deadline. They will also deal with any responses from defendants. They can also assist you to obtain the necessary documentation, such as medical records or employment records.

Review of case

A New York mesothelioma attorney will look over your medical records and work history to determine if there's a case for compensation. They will also document asbestos exposure and identify possible defendants. They may also file a lawsuit to hold companies accountable and to get the justice you deserve. A defendant might attempt to delay or deflect the claim by filing frivolous lawsuits, however, an experienced attorney can stop this tactic and ensure that your case gets moving quickly.

Compensation for mesothelioma is used to pay for cancer treatment and travel expenses as well as lost earnings and compensation for patients and their families. Compensation can also cover funeral expenses and help the surviving family members financially to support themselves. Mesothelioma patients seek compensation from companies that exposed them to asbestos in a negligent manner.

The mesothelioma lawsuit process can take several years to complete. Most mesothelioma cases end with a settlement before trial. However, some cases need to go to trial due to complicated issues and lengthy discovery procedures. A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will help you get the best results. They can make sure that your claim is filed correctly and on time. They can spot any procedural mistakes or inconsequential information from being made available to defendants, and determine the fairness of a settlement offer.

If doctors suspect mesothelioma tumor or mesothelioma mass, they may order an in-depth biopsy to determine if cancerous cells are present. Doctors typically take a small sample of the mass or tumor by using a needle, or surgically remove the mass surgically. This is then examined under a microscope in order to determine if the cells are cancerous.

The most commonly used mesothelioma claims type is called mesothelioma pleural that affects the lining of the chest cavity (called the pleura) and the lungs. Other types include peritoneal melanoma, pericardial mesothelioma, and mesothelioma testicularis. Testicular mesothelioma is the most rare form and develops on the membrane lining the testes. Patients who have been exposed to asbestos typically suffer from pleural melanoma, but they can be diagnosed with other types of the disease. People with mesothelioma typically have a low prognosis, but it is important to remember that every patient's case is distinct.

Settlement negotiations

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ma are able to represent their clients in settlement negotiations. These negotiations are an important part of the legal system. These negotiations are designed to settle cases without having to go to court. They cover a range of issues, like the payment of monetary compensation. Settlements are recorded in a legally binding document referred to as a deed release.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will understand the needs of their clients and bargain for a fair amount. In order to begin the process, both parties must agree on a range of financial limits. To achieve this, you need to understand your client's circumstances, including their financial limitations and the possible impact of a verdict on their future.

Trial

A mesothelioma-related case requires a lot of research, investigation, gathering of evidence, and finally filing. A New York mesothelioma attorney can help you avoid pitfalls, and speed up the process. They can represent your family members at pretrial hearings and motions and defend you against unfounded dismissals on legal technical grounds.

Mesothelioma lawyers are also able to assist you in valuing your mesothelioma claim. This involves estimating both economic costs like medical bills, as well as non-economic damages such as suffering and pain. Lawyers who have experience in mesothelioma litigation know how to calculate these amounts based on past case outcomes and your particular circumstances.

Asbestos exposure victims usually file multiple claims against various businesses. The companies could relocate to different states or countries, change their names, go bankrupt or acquire businesses. A mesothelioma lawyer will help locate these companies, and also connect you with other asbestos-related companies, bolstering your case.

A mesothelioma lawsuits lawsuit that is successful can result in compensation to pay for past and future medical costs, lost wages, lost earning ability, legal fees as well as discomfort and pain. These settlements can help a family pay off debts, improve their standard of living and have hope for the future. Many families are awarded a settlement or jury award in the millions of dollars. However, certain mesothelioma cases have to go to trial due to defendants refusing to settle.
